Which leadership style was identified by the Michigan University leadership studies as the most effective?
ADemocratic style leadership
BEmployee-centered leadership ✓ Correct
CParticipative group leadership
DTeam leadership
Correct answer: (B) Employee-centered leadership — The Michigan studies favoured employee-centered leadership, so that is the answer.
Explanation
★The Michigan studies favoured employee-centered leadership, so that is the answer.
★They contrasted employee-centered with job-centered styles.
★Employee-centered leaders focus on people and their needs.
★This was found to raise satisfaction and output.
★It builds supportive relations with subordinates.
